Michigan Code § 400.201

Michigan Children's Institute; Creation; Transfer of Records and Property From State Public School.

Sec. 1.
That in order the state may more effectively exercise the duty and obligation which it owes to unfortunate children, there is hereby created and established the Michigan children's institute. Such records, papers, equipment and appurtenances as needed from the state public school shall be transferred to the said institute and whenever the name "state public school" appears in any statute of this state it shall be taken and deemed to mean the Michigan children's institute.
History: 1935, Act 220, Imd. Eff. June 8, 1935 ;-- CL 1948, 400.201 Former Law: See Act 143 of 1903 and Act 164 of 1931.
